1. Before calling for assistance...

Performance problems often result from little things you can find and fix yourself without tools of any kind.

If your dishwasher will not run, or stops during a cycle:

lIs the door tightly closed and securely latched?

lHas the cycle been correctly set and the Start/ Favorite pad pressed?

lIs the water turned on?

lHave you checked your home’s main fuses or circuit breaker box?

lIs the dishwasher wired into a live circuit with the proper voltage?

lIf the motor has stopped because of an overload, it will automatically reset itself within a few min- utes If the motor does not start, call for service.

lIs the delay feature on?

If your dishwasher seems to run too long:

l Is your household water temperature set too low? Low water temperature settings will cause longer dishwasher operating times.

lAre you using Pots & Pans Cycle or Hi-Temp Option? The dishwasher may be waiting for the water to heat.

If dishwasher won’t fill:

lIs overfill protector stuck in “up” position? Overfill protector should move up and down freely. Press down to release.

If water remains in the dishwasher:

lHas the cycle completed?

l A small amount of remaining water is normal.

. Is drain air gap clogged?

If detergent remains in the covered detergent cup:

lIs the bottom rack in backwards? (The rack bumpers should be at the front.)

l Is the dishwasner detergent fresh and dry without lumps?

lIs the cycle completed?

If HI-TEMP LESS THAN 135” indicator shows at the end of a cycle:

lHave you run water at the nearest sink before starting the dishwasher?

l Is water temperature at the household water heater at least 140°F (60”(Z)? Set water heater thermostat to a higher setting.

If CA shows on the display:

lHas there been a power failure?

lHas the door been open longer than 2 hours? (See page 11)

If “LOCKED” shows on the display or the control pads don’t work:

lIs the lock-out feature on? (See page 7)

If the beep does not sound when pads are pressed:

l Has the sound signal been turned off? (See page 8)

If white residue appears on front of access panel:

l Is more detergent being used than needed? See page 19 for recommended amounts of detergent.

l Some liquid detergents develop excess foam and build up on exterior of access panel. Try a different brand to reduce foaming and eliminate build-up.

If you hear grinding, grating, crunching, buzzing sounds:

l A hard object has probably entered the POWER CLEAN’” Module. The sound should stop when the object is ground up.

If dishes aren’t as dry as you expected:

l Is the rinse agent dispenser filled? Using a rinse agent greatly improves drying. (See page 20.)
